Hi, Since we upgraded to Debian Lenny (auth daemon 0.61), we are experiencing a memory leak in the Courier Authdaemon. Since then we upgraded to testing (auth daemon 0.63), to see if the problem was already solved. But it is not. Debian sarge did not have this problem.
Because a graph tells a lot more than words, please see the attached image. You can see the memory slowly leaking away, the os gives up the cache more and more until no memory is left. At that moment the auth daemon states that it can not fork anymore (and an input/ouput error) and gives up. At ~9:15, Ive done a restart on the authdaemon only (not on any other process) and you see instantly the memory is released back to the operating system. And of course this repeats itself. After 1,5 days we again have the same problem. This machine only runs courier. The authentication is happening against PAM which auths against an LDAP directory. The OS is Debian testing, and the following courier versions are installed: ii courier-authdaemon 0.63.0-2 ii courier-authlib 0.63.0-2 ii courier-base 0.65.0-1 ii courier-imap 4.8.0-1 ii courier-imap-ssl 4.8.0-1 ii courier-pop 0.65.0-1 ii courier-pop-ssl 0.65.0-1 ii courier-ssl 0.65.0-1 If you need any more information let me know.
